Malkara

Malkara is a village located in Amb tehsil of Una district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 16km away from district headquarter Amb. Amb is the sub-district headquarter of Malkara village. As per 2009 stats, Sathothar is the gram panchayat of Malkara village.

About Malkara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Malkara is 018341. The village spans a total geographical area of 157 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 174316. Una is nearest town to Malkara village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Malkara village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Chintpurni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Malkara

Below is a concise population overview of Malkara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 784 385 399
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 102 49 53
Scheduled Castes (SC) 221 111 110
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 533 288 245
Illiterate Population 251 97 154

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Malkara village:

  • The total population of Malkara village is around 784, including approximately 385 males and 399 females, with a sex ratio of 1036 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 102 children aged 0–6 years in Malkara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Malkara village has 221 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Malkara village is about 67.98%, with male literacy at 74.81% and female literacy at 61.40%.
  • There are around 165 households in Malkara village.

Connectivity of Malkara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Malkara. As per the 2011 stats, Malkara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
